std::money_put<CharT,OutputIt>::put, do_put
Min standard notice:
Header: <locale>
Formats monetary value and writes the result to output stream.
# Declarations
public:
iter_type put( iter_type out, bool intl, std::ios_base& f,
char_type fill, long double quant ) const;
iter_type put( iter_type out, bool intl, std::ios_base& f,
char_type fill, const string_type& quant ) const;
protected:
virtual iter_type do_put( iter_type out, bool intl, std::ios_base& str,
char_type fill, long double units ) const;
virtual iter_type do_put( iter_type out, bool intl, std::ios_base& str,
char_type fill, const string_type& digits ) const;
# Return value
An iterator pointing immediately after the last character produced.
# Notes
The currency units are assumed to be the smallest non-fractional units of the currency: cents in the U.S, yen in Japan.

# Defect reports
| DR | Applied to | Behavior as published | Correct behavior |
|---|---|---|---|
| LWG 328 | C++98 | the format string used for std::sprintf was “%.01f” | corrected to “%.0Lf” |
